With 180 marks in JEE Mains 2026, candidates will get a percentile between 98 to 99. To calculate the percentile, NTA follows the JEE normalisation process. With 180 marks, students can get admission to good NITs and IIITs. Here are the details.

The candidate's percentile score is calculated as follows: 100 x (total number of candidates who appeared in that session) / (number of candidates who secured a raw score (or real score) equal to or less than the candidate)
| Total Percentile TP1 | 100 x (No. of candidates from the session with raw score equal to or less than T1 score) / Total No. of candidates appeared in the session |
|---|---|
Mathematics Percentile M1P | 100x (The number of candidates that entered the session and had a raw score in mathematics that was either equal to or lower than the M1 score) / Number of candidates that participated in the session overall |
Physics Percentile P1P | (100 × No. of candidates who showed up from the session and whose raw score in Physics was equal to or lower than the P1 score) / Total No. of applicants who showed up during the session |
Chemistry Percentile C1P | (100 times the number of applicants who showed up from the session and whose raw score in Chemistry was equivalent to or lower than a C1) / The total number of candidates who showed up for the session |

180 is considered a good score and it opens the way to getting admission into top NITs, IIITs and GFTIs.
180 marks can get you anywhere around the 98-99 percentile. However, it depends on several other factors such as the number of students who appeared for the exam.
With complete dedication and constant efforts of practice, one can score top. Practice is the key that makes the man perfect.
180-198 marks fetch you around 5000 to 7000. However, it is necessary to know that the ranks and marks keep fluctuating due to many factors. These are just the expected ranks.
Top colleges accepting 180 marks in JEE Main are IIIT Allahabad, IIIT Lucknow, NIT Tiruchirappalli, NIT Delhi, NIT Kurukshetra, NIT Calicut and many more.
